Warning Signs Your AC Requires Service?

When property owners observe unusual variations in their indoor temperature, it often signals that their air conditioning system might need repair. Additional indicators include uncommon noises, such as grinding or hissing, which can suggest mechanical problems or refrigerant leaks. Moreover, pooling water around the unit may point to a obstructed drain line or a refrigerant leak, both requiring immediate attention. Homeowners should also be vigilant for unusual odors emanating from the AC, as these could mean mold growth or electrical issues. If the system frequently cycles on and off, it could be a sign of an inefficient thermostat or other hidden problems. Lastly, a noticeable increase in energy bills without a change in usage patterns can suggest a faulty unit. Recognizing these signs early can prevent more extensive damage and ensure the air conditioning system runs efficiently.

Low Air Flow Issues

Poor airflow issues can significantly affect an air conditioning system's efficiency and comfort levels. These issues often result from clogged air filters, which limit air flow and force the system to work harder. Additionally, obstructed ductwork and vents can prevent cool air from circulating properly throughout the home. Another potential cause is a malfunctioning blower motor, which may be unable to push air sufficiently. Homeowners should frequently check and swap out filters, making sure ducts are clear of obstructions. Ignoring low airflow can result in higher energy costs and can strain the system, causing more serious issues down the line. Addressing these concerns promptly helps maintain peak performance and extends the life span of the air conditioning unit.

Strange Sounds Appearance

Odd sounds from an air conditioning unit can indicate hidden issues that need immediate attention. Common sounds like grinding, hissing, or rattling frequently indicate mechanical faults. A grinding sound may suggest worn bearings or a motor that is malfunctioning. Hissing typically indicates refrigerant leaks, which lower efficiency and lead to expensive repairs. Rattling noises often come from loose components or debris inside the unit. These noises should not be overlooked as they might escalate into more serious problems if not addressed. Timely maintenance and diagnosis by a professional technician can help resolving these issues, making sure the air conditioning system operates efficiently during the summer months. Homeowners should monitor these noises carefully to ensure optimal performance.

Important Care Tips to Maximize Your AC Performance

Ensuring ideal air conditioning operation copyrights on a few essential practices. Regularly replacing or cleaning air filters is vital, as clogged filters restrict airflow and lower efficiency. Homeowners should inspect filters monthly and replace them every one to three months, depending on usage. Keeping the outdoor unit clear of particles, such as leaves and dirt, also enhances airflow, allowing the system to work at its best.

Additionally, planning routine professional servicing can spot emerging problems before they get worse. Technicians can clean coils, assess coolant status, and confirm all parts are working properly. Homeowners should also explore duct sealing options to eliminate air loss, which can cause energy waste. Finally, maintaining a fixed thermostat level can minimize stress on the system. By implementing these vital maintenance strategies, homeowners can improve cooling system output and promise a comfortable, cool setting during the summer months.

Do-It-Yourself Air Conditioning Repair Advice

Diagnosing AC problems can enable homeowners to tackle get the full story minor issues before they escalate. One of the initial actions is to verify the thermostat configuration; ensuring it's set to "cool" and the preferred temperature is appropriate can fix many problems. Homeowners should also inspect the air filter, as a clogged filter can limit airflow and stress the system. Cleaning or replacing the filter frequently is essential for optimal performance.

Next, examining the external component for blockages and obstacles is essential. Clearing foliage, dust, and various debris can enhance air circulation and performance. Additionally, inspecting for frost accumulation on the evaporator coils can indicate a coolant problem or airflow problem.

Finally, listening for unusual sounds during use may indicate mechanical issues. By adhering to these simple diagnostic guidelines, homeowners can often identify and resolve minor AC issues, ensuring their home remains cool throughout the summer months.

When is it advisable enlisting a professional for AC restoration?

When dealing with ongoing air conditioning problems, how can property owners decide when it's time to contact a expert? A few important signs can guide this choice. First, if the unit is blowing warm air despite being set to cool, it may suggest a refrigerant leak or compressor issue. Additionally, strange noises, such as grinding or screeching, often indicate mechanical failures that demand expert attention.

Repeated cycling, where the unit turns off and on repeatedly, can also suggest underlying problems that could deteriorate over time. Homeowners should monitor rising energy bills, as inefficiencies often derive from malfunctioning components.

Finally, if the system is over 10 years old and needs several fixes, it may be more cost-effective to consult a professional for a complete evaluation. Recognizing these signs can help guarantee that the air conditioning system runs smoothly throughout the summer months.

Factors Influencing AC Service Expenses

Recognizing the demand for qualified AC work is just the beginning; understanding the aspects that influence repair costs is equally vital. Several considerations can considerably affect the final bill. First, the type of repair needed takes a crucial position; minor fixes typically expense less than major component swaps. The years of use and brand of the air conditioning unit also matter, as older models may call for specialized parts that are harder to find and more expensive.

Labor charges vary by location and service provider, with some technicians asking for higher rates due to their ability or demand. Also, the time of year can impact pricing, as repairs are often more costly during peak summer months when demand rises. Lastly, extra services, such as regular check-ups or diagnostic fees, may add to the overall cost. Being aware of these factors enables homeowners to make educated decisions when seeking AC repair services.

How Regular Times Should I Book Specialized AC Upkeep?

Specialists recommend planning AC maintenance at least once a year, ideally before the cooling season commences. Frequent inspections can prevent failures, enhance performance, and maximize the life of the air conditioning system.

May I Operate My AC When the Power Goes Out?

When a power outage occurs, air conditioning units are unable to work, since they depend on electricity. Nevertheless, certain homeowners might use power generators to supply power to their systems on a short-term basis, maintaining comfort until power returns. Careful precautions are necessary when employing this method.

Do eco-friendly AC alternatives exist for my property?

Various energy-saving air conditioning choices exist, including inverter systems, ductless mini-splits, and ENERGY STAR-rated units. These alternatives reduce energy consumption while preserving comfort, ultimately resulting in lower utility bills and a lighter environmental footprint.
